I searched several threads to find this answer but no luck yet. I have a '79 F250, 460, manual that I want to switch over to a C6. As I understand it, any 400 or 460 4x4 C6 will work? Are there two different output shaft lengths? I'm in Alaska so I'd like to get the parts right the first time. My list:
auto steering column
different brake pedal assembly
kick down linkage
flex plate
neutral safety switch wiring

You shouldn't have any wiring to your trans at all. You may also need a different drive shafts and cross member. If I rember correctly you should have a t-18 if so the t-18 is shorter than a c6.
I think the starters are different between the manual and auto.
Auto cooling lines typically go through the radiator for cooling. Either you'll have to swap out the rad or add a trans cooler to the front of it.
